Forum de mathématiques - Bibm@th.net
Bienvenue dans les forums du site BibM@th, des forums où on dit Bonjour (Bonsoir), Merci, S'il vous plaît...
Vous n'êtes pas identifié(e).
- Contributions : Récentes | Sans réponse
#1 27-02-2012 11:05:26
- vladimire
- Membre
- Inscription : 16-02-2012
- Messages : 3
Exercices corrigés de models de calcul
Bonjour,
Je cherche des exercices et corrigés en model de calculs (Récursion primitive, Fonction D'Ackermann..)
J'ai cherché dans la partie Exercice/corrigé du site mais il y'en avait pas.
Je vous remercie d'avance.
Hors ligne
#2 27-02-2012 17:31:33
- totomm
- Membre
- Inscription : 25-08-2011
- Messages : 1 093
Re : Exercices corrigés de models de calcul
Bonjour,
La fonction d'ackermann en Python, appelée pour m=2,n=2
#Python 3.2
#Fonction d'Ackermann
def A(m,n):
print("A(",m,n,")") #imprimer chacun des appels récursifs
if m==0:
return n+1
else:
if n==0:
return A(m-1,1)
else:
X=A(m,n-1)
return A(m-1,X)
m,n=2,2
print("A(",m,n,") =",A(m,n)) #Imprimer le résultat A(2,2) = 7
#Fonction d'Ackermann
def A(m,n):
print("A(",m,n,")") #imprimer chacun des appels récursifs
if m==0:
return n+1
else:
if n==0:
return A(m-1,1)
else:
X=A(m,n-1)
return A(m-1,X)
m,n=2,2
print("A(",m,n,") =",A(m,n)) #Imprimer le résultat A(2,2) = 7
Cordialement
Hors ligne
#3 12-03-2012 20:02:37
- vladimire
- Membre
- Inscription : 16-02-2012
- Messages : 3
Re : Exercices corrigés de models de calcul
Bonsoir,
Je te remercie Totomm pour la fonction d'Ackermann !
Je cherche aussi des exercices sur les preuves et démonstration mathématiques du genre : Démonstration dans PA de la formule :
(B-->(B-->A))-->(B-->A)
ou encore
((A-->C)v(A-->B))-->(A-->(BvC))
Dernière modification par yoshi (12-03-2012 20:19:06)
Hors ligne







